Many families delay looking into Home Care Vancouver until something urgent happens. A common question is when is the right time to actually begin. In most cases, starting earlier leads to better outcomes and a smoother transition.
One of the clearest signs is difficulty with daily routines. If your parent is struggling with cooking, cleaning, or personal care, In Home Senior Care Vancouver can provide the extra support needed to stay safe at home.
Memory changes are another indicator. Forgetting medications, appointments, or becoming confused can increase risks. Professional Caregivers Vancouver families trust can help create structure and consistency.
Mobility issues, such as unsteadiness or recent falls, are also important signals. Personalized Home Care Services Vancouver can reduce fall risks through supervision and assistance.
It is also important to consider family stress. If you feel overwhelmed trying to balance care with your own responsibilities, Respite Care Vancouver can provide immediate relief.
Starting early allows seniors to adjust gradually. Elder Care Vancouver does not have to begin with full time support. Many families start with a few hours per week and increase care as needed.
If conditions progress, services can expand to more consistent care or even 24 Hour Home Care Vancouver.
Senior Care Vancouver works best when it is proactive, not reactive. Beginning care at the right time helps maintain independence, prevent crises, and create a more positive long term care experience.
